Output f27e6c64c38cc9ca29ebcf6a8f245025d65ded1ad6f932779ea0346e6a69d788:6

value
2911652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c20bfa6dfa2cf609fe9b425d041ad0de81a160da OP_EQUAL
address
3KP3N2CvrsJzYFzk2TQFj2A6mLKJN1jNyT
transaction
f27e6c64c38cc9ca29ebcf6a8f245025d65ded1ad6f932779ea0346e6a69d788
confirmations
464438
spent
true